手工指定的方式

1
2
ipconfig fxp0 192.168.8.33/24 # 添加网卡ip
route add default 192.168.8.1 # 添加路由(也可理解为网关)

立即生效,但是重启后失效。
如何重启后仍然保持呢?

1
2
3
4
5
ee /etc/rc.conf
ifconfig_fxp0=”inet 192.168.8.8 netmask 255.255.255.0 “ # fxp0 网卡地址和子网掩码
defaultrouter=”192.168.8.10” # 网关地址
hostname=”study.nowire.com.cn” # 机器名
ifconfig_wi0=”inet 192.168.8.55 netmask 255.255.255.0” # wi0 网卡地址,对应无线网卡

修改 /etc/rc.conf 配置之后可以通过如下方式生效:
第一种方法:# sh /etc/rc
第二种方法:# /etc/netstart
第三种方法:重启机器

DHCP 方式
在 /etc/rc.conf 中添加:

1
ifconfig_fxp0=”DHCP”

需要根据具体情况指定网卡名称。

修改 /etc/rc.conf 配置之后可以通过如下方式生效:
第一种方法:# sh /etc/rc
第二种方法:# /etc/netstart
第三种方法:重启机器

关于 DNS 地址的配置

1
2
3
ee /etc/resolv.conf
nameserver 202.96.209.133
nameserver 202.96.209.5

控制网卡的开关

1
2
ifconfig fxp0 up
ifconfig fxp0 down

路由方面的配置
查看路由

1
netstat -rn

添加路由(相当于配置gateway)

1
route add default 192.168.8.1 # 192.168.8.1为网关地址

如果要修改当前路由配置,需要先删除,再新增一条,当然如果不是同名的,如不是default的可以直接添加

1
2
route delete default 192.168.8.1
route add default 192.168.8.10